JUDGMENT
WOOD, J.
Per her Petition, the wife Petitioner seeks the dissolution of the marriage between herself and the Respondent on the grounds of adultery, desertion and unreasonable conduct and prays for the following reliefs:
I. The sum of GH¢10,000.00 as alimony or permanent financial settlement. II. Maintenance of GH¢250.00 pendente lite from September 2012 to date of dissolution of the marriage.
III. Legal costs of the proceedings incurred by the Petitioner in the total sum of GH¢3,000.00
The Respondent in his Answer says the Petitioner is not entitled to any of the reliefs endorsed in the Petition and prays for the dissolution of the marriage celebrated between the parties.
